The Five-Minute Walk is a standard that is best described as the average distance that a pedestrian is willing to walk before opting to drive. Enter an address, city, or zip code, and a radius, and you will get the radius drawn on the map. The unit of measurement is commonplace in the planning profession and is often represented by a radius measuring ¼ of a mile.
